BACKGROUND: Left ventricular diastolic dysfunction indicated by elevated pulmonary capillary wedge pressure (ePCWP) may worsen cardiorespiratory status in bronchopulmonary dysplasia (BPD), but the scope of ePCWP by cardiac catheterization is not well described. METHODS: This single-center retrospective cohort study included infants with BPD without congenital heart disease, significant intracardiac shunts, or pulmonary vein stenosis who underwent cardiac catheterization from 2010 to 2021. ePCWP was defined as >10 mmHg. Quantitative measures of ventricular systolic and diastolic function were performed on existing echocardiograms. Patients with and without ePCWP were compared using the Chi-squared or Wilcoxon rank-sum tests. Associations between catheterization hemodynamics and echocardiographic parameters were assessed by simple linear regression. RESULTS: Seventy-one infants (93% Grade 2 or 3 BPD) met inclusion criteria, and 30 (42%) had ePCWP. Patients with ePCWP were older at catheterization (6.7 vs. 4.5 months, p < 0.001), more commonly underwent tracheostomy (66.7% vs. 29.3%, p = 0.003), and had higher mean systemic blood pressure [64.5 (56.0, 75.0) vs. 47.0 (43.0, 55.0) mm Hg, p < 0.001], higher systemic vascular resistance [11.9 (10.4, 15.6) vs. 8.7 (6.7, 11.2) WU*m2, p < 0.001), and lower cardiac index [3.9 (3.8, 4.9) vs. 4.7 (4.0, 6.3) L/min/m2, p = 0.03] at catheterization. Mean pulmonary artery pressure, pulmonary vascular resistance, and mortality were similar between the groups. Echocardiographic indices of left ventricular diastolic dysfunction did not correlate with PCWP. CONCLUSIONS: ePCWP was common in infants with severe BPD who underwent cardiac catheterization in this cohort. The association between ePCWP and higher systemic blood pressure supports further study of afterload reduction in this population.

OBJECTIVES: To measure between-center variation in loop diuretic use in infants developing severe bronchopulmonary dysplasia (BPD) in US children's hospitals, and to compare mortality and age at discharge between infants from low-use centers and infants from high-use centers. STUDY DESIGN: We performed a retrospective cohort study of preterm infants at <32 weeks of gestational age with severe BPD. The primary outcome was cumulative loop diuretic use, defined as the proportion of days with exposure between admission and discharge. Infant characteristics associated with loop diuretic use at P < .10 were included in multivariable models to adjust for center differences in case mix. Hospitals were ranked from lowest to highest in adjusted use and dichotomized into low-use centers and high-use centers. We then compared mortality and postmenstrual age at discharge between the groups through multivariable analyses. RESULTS: We identified 3252 subjects from 43 centers. Significant variation between centers remained despite adjustment for infant characteristics, with use present in an adjusted mean range of 7.3% to 49.4% of days (P < .0001). Mortality did not differ significantly between the 2 groups (aOR, 0.98; 95% CI, 0.62-1.53; P = .92), nor did postmenstrual age at discharge (marginal mean, 47.3 weeks [95% CI, 46.8-47.9 weeks] in the low-use group vs 47.4 weeks [95% CI, 46.9-47.9 weeks] in the high-use group; P = .96). CONCLUSIONS: A marked variation in loop diuretic use for infants developing severe BPD exists among US children's hospitals, without an observed difference in mortality or age at discharge. More research is needed to provide evidence-based guidance for this common exposure.
